Reprint of a key work on American whaling which, gives a general picture of life on a whaling ship in the 1840s and... contains much information relevant to whaling in the Pacific Ocean. - Forster 11. It was also an important source and inspiration for Herman Melville, who reviewed this book for Literary World in 1847. Jenkins p. 84. Howes B-877. This edition of Browne's classic comes with a scholarly introduction by John Seelye, and is a good opportunity for those unable or unwilling to scratch up the $$ for a first edition.
